Sukta 85
वि तर्तूर्यन्ते मघवन् विपश्चितोऽर्यो विपो जनानाम्। उप क्रमस्व पुरुरूपमा भर वाजं नेदिष्ठमूतये
ví tártūryante maghavan vipaścíto ’áryo vípo jánānām | úpa krámasva pururū́pam ā́ bhara vā́jaṃ nédiṣṭham ūtáye |
Forth press the wise and far-discerning, O Bounteous; the noble, the inspired of the peoples. Step hither; bring, in thy many-formed might, the prize most near at hand, for our succour.
Rishi: Rigvedic attribution (Indra-stotra tradition; AV 20 is largely RV reprise—specific r̥ṣi per RV anukramaṇī for the source verse).
Devata: Indra (Maghavan)
Chandas: Triṣṭubh/Jagatī-type cadence as in RV Indra-stotras (source-dependent)
